222562065920000000 is an even composite number. It is composed of three dist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of five hundred twelve divisors.

Prime factorization of 222562065920000000:

215 × 57 × 4433

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 5 × 5 × 5 × 5 × 5 × 5 × 5 × 443 × 443 × 443)
